Context

For decades, schools did not provide real English. War made it critical

Because of the historical influence of the USSR, access to quality English education in Ukraine was limited. Even after independence, many schools did not provide the level needed for real-life communication. Generations of Ukrainians grew up without confidence in speaking English.

In recent years—especially since the start of the war—the importance of English has grown sharply. Many Ukrainians live abroad as refugees. Others are adapting to new realities at home.

But alongside the language barrier, another one appeared: fear of making mistakes, fear of speaking, and a cultural tendency to feel ashamed. Feel Free Camp was created to remove both.

What it looks like

Safe, warm, international

Our idea is to create an environment where people can practice English in real conversations, not in textbook exercises. Where you can make mistakes without shame. Where you meet people from different cultures.

We chose a base in western Ukraine—near Mukachevo, in one of the safest regions of the country during wartime. Despite the difficulties, the first season turned out to be successful.

Beyond language, the camp becomes a place of encouragement, friendship, and spiritual reflection. Many participants receive genuine care and support during a difficult period of life.
